X-Git-Url: http://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=blobdiff_plain;f=src%2Fsystemd%2Fsd-login.h;h=24c8595064275e1d6c2ccc37960ddd797481ddb2;hp=1eb3be30b53f454a5527fe174e314e942040ed1f;hb=3d3b472432f270299c6d5ddc58443eee852b0550;hpb=634af5665fda8776d22624d947c8de830e30a874 diff --git a/src/systemd/sd-login.h b/src/systemd/sd-login.h index 1eb3be30b..24c859506 100644 --- a/src/systemd/sd-login.h +++ b/src/systemd/sd-login.h @@ -119,7 +119,7 @@ int sd_uid_get_sessions(uid_t uid, int require_active, char ***sessions); /* Return seats of user is on. If require_active is true, this will look for * active seats only. Returns the number of seats. - * If seats is NULL, this will just return the number of seats.*/ + * If seats is NULL, this will just return the number of seats. */ int sd_uid_get_seats(uid_t uid, int require_active, char ***seats); /* Return 1 if the session is active. */ @@ -147,6 +147,9 @@ int sd_session_get_type(const char *session, char **type); /* Determine the class of this session, i.e. one of "user", "greeter" or "lock-screen". */ int sd_session_get_class(const char *session, char **clazz); +/* Determine the desktop brand of this session, i.e. something like "GNOME", "KDE" or "systemd-console". */ +int sd_session_get_desktop(const char *session, char **desktop); + /* Determine the X11 display of this session. */ int sd_session_get_display(const char *session, char **display);